Job Description  

The   Flex   Radiologic   Technologist (RT) works with   Medical Provider s and/ or   a Medical   Assistant s with the examination and treatment of   GoHealth   Urgent Care patients. This role   is responsible for   providing   a variety of technical procedures   and   apply   prescribed ionizing radiation for radio l ogic diagnosis   for our   GoHealth   Urgent Care patients.   This role   is   responsible for   perform ing and analyzing   patient x-rays and repo rting results to   Medical Provider s .   Additional   responsibilities include   providing administrative support to ensure efficient operatio n of   GoHealth   Urgent Care Centers .   In a collaborative manner, the Radiologic Technologist will provide support to   Medical Providers, Medical   Assistants   and patients through a variety of tasks related to patient care management,   organization   and communication.  

The   Flex   RT   complete s   all activities accurately, with high   quality and in a timely manner while living our   vision   and mission t o become the urgent care   p artner   of choice by re-defining value and   access to quality care   through:   an effortless experience, a   culture of care,   and s eamlessly integrating   with our partners and communities . This vision is achieved through our five core values of Collaboration, Innovation, Diversity and Inclusion,   Integrity   and Accountability .  

The Flex RT does not anchor at   a one   particular urgent   care site.   The Flex RT works across sites   in close proximity to   one another.   As patient care needs arise requiring X-ray, the Flex   R T travels from to the respective site to   render   care. The travel nature of this role   enables to   Flex   R T to be exposed to a variety of urgent care settings and maximizes quantity of X-Rays an RT performs.   

Job Requirements  

Education  

• Graduate of an approved Radiologic Technology program   required  

• High School Diploma or equivalent required  

Work Experience  

• Experience in a clinical setting preferred  

Required Licenses/Certifications  

• Basic Life Support (BLS)   required   at the time of hire (obtained through the American Red Cross (ARC) or American Heart Association (AHA).  

• American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) registration   required .  

• Applicable state licensure as a Radiologic Technologist   required .  

Essential Functions  

• Responsible for x-ray services as needed  

• Under the direction of the clinical provider, perform x-ray services for patients by applying x-ray energy to   assist   in diagnosis or treatment of patients in all age groups from newborn to elderly.  

• Ensure patients are positioned correctly on or in front of equipment and protected during use.  

• Will need to push patient in a wheelchair  

Patient Preparation and Rooming  

• Inform technical staff of patient flow.  

• Prepare patients for examination, which includes conducting interviews to verify patient information, record medical history; confirm purpose of visit;  

• Perform preliminary physical tests (blood pressure, weight, temperature, etc.) for vital signs and escalate critical cases to the provider as needed.  

• Conduct point of care testing as needed (i.e., flu, strep, urinalysis, ECG, HCG); and provide patient information to providers.  

Administrative  

• Responsible for maintenance of medical records and scanning charts to patient files.  

• Conduct courtesy call-backs for patient follow-up on care  

• Follow operating instructions to perform and document daily controls and calibration of equipment;   maintain   Quality Assurance/Quality Control logs for equipment troubleshoot breakdowns, perform preventive maintenance, and   submit   repair tickets as needed
